#416: [INTRODUCING] AWS CloudShell

December 27, 2020 00:16:18 23.82 MB Downloads: 0

AWS CloudShell is a browser-based shell that makes it easy to securely interact with your AWS resources. CloudShell is pre-authenticated with your console credentials and common development and operations tools are pre-installed, so no local installation or configuration is required. Today Simon is joined by Jonathan Weiss, a Senior Manager of Software Development at AWS, to learn all about this recently launched service. Simon and Jonathan will explore the benefits of CloudShell, why AWS built the the service, who it’s for, and the top use cases that CloudShell helps to facilitate. https://aws.amazon.com/cloudshell/

#409: Exploring AWS Snowcone

November 18, 2020 00:27:58 40.61 MB Downloads: 0

AWS Snowcone is the smallest member of the AWS Snow Family of edge computing, edge storage, and data transfer devices, weighing in at 4.5 pounds (2.1 kg) with 8 terabytes of usable storage. Snowcone is ruggedized, secure, and purpose-built for use outside of a traditional data center. Its small form factor makes it a perfect fit for tight spaces or where portability is a necessity. You can use Snowcone in backpacks on first responders, or for IoT, vehicular, and even drone use cases. In this podcast, learn about the importance of computing at the edge, how the AWS Snow Family helps customers with compute and data transfer applications at the edge, and the benefits and use cases of AWS Snowcone.
